Output 3f9530b8bc381b2b6568e3c0473e0edb2e1f3d88f5e23593b94516ab65a7d4a8:0

value
500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5c7db3e7af8dab83506da116390ec6baaee0228 OP_EQUAL
address
3MBPGftTRX1im4dsUs8CgwRTaoBHzDXvZS
transaction
3f9530b8bc381b2b6568e3c0473e0edb2e1f3d88f5e23593b94516ab65a7d4a8